Mike Williams in the 2010 NFL Draft

Mike Williams is a Wide receiver out of Syracuse selected No. 101 overall by the Tampa Bay Buccaneers in the 2010 NFL Draft. 63 regular-season games · 3 seasons as a starter · 25 career approximate value Syracuse has produced 106 NFL draft picks since 1980.
